技术文摘
PHP 中用于输出数据类型的函数是哪个
2025-01-09 00:04:52 小编
PHP 中用于输出数据类型的函数是哪个
在PHP编程中,经常会遇到需要确定变量数据类型的情况。那么,PHP中用于输出数据类型的函数是哪个呢?答案是gettype()函数。
gettype()函数是PHP中一个非常实用的内置函数,它的作用就是返回变量的数据类型。这个函数的使用非常简单,只需要将需要检测的变量作为参数传递给它,它就会返回该变量的数据类型。
例如,以下是一个简单的PHP代码示例:
<?php
$var1 = 10;
$var2 = "Hello World";
$var3 = array(1, 2, 3);
echo gettype($var1); // 输出:integer
echo gettype($var2); // 输出:string
echo gettype($var3); // 输出:array
?>
在这个示例中,我们分别定义了一个整数变量、一个字符串变量和一个数组变量,然后使用gettype()函数来输出它们的数据类型。
除了gettype()函数,PHP中还有一些其他的函数可以用来检测变量的数据类型,比如is_int()、is_string()、is_array()等。这些函数的作用是判断一个变量是否属于某种特定的数据类型,它们返回的是一个布尔值,即true或false。
例如:
<?php
$var = 10;
if (is_int($var)) {
echo "变量是整数类型";
} else {
echo "变量不是整数类型";
}
?>
在实际的PHP开发中,了解和掌握这些用于检测数据类型的函数是非常重要的。它们可以帮助我们更好地处理和操作变量,避免因为数据类型不匹配而导致的错误。
例如,在进行数据验证和过滤时,我们可以使用这些函数来确保用户输入的数据符合我们的预期。在进行数据转换和处理时,我们也可以根据变量的数据类型来选择合适的方法。
gettype()函数是PHP中用于输出数据类型的重要函数之一,它与其他相关的函数一起,为我们在PHP编程中处理数据类型提供了方便和保障。熟练掌握这些函数的使用,将有助于提高我们的PHP编程技能和开发效率。
- 线上 JVM GC 长暂停排查:漫长的加班之旅
- 三分钟掌握负载均衡重要性及 Ribbon 集成
- Echarts 宣布更新:体积骤减 98%,UI 特效更美观
- Spring Boot 中外部接口的调用:RestTemplate 与 WebClient 对 HTTP 的操控
- 奥特曼重返 OpenAI 董事会 新成员披露 马斯克反应惊人 网友:权力博弈 Ilya 去向成谜
- 十个让双手解放的 IDEA 插件 减少冤枉代码
- 程序员写汇编游戏狂赚 3000 万美元,令人震惊!
- 企业级大模型开发的专属框架、工具与模型
- 常见的 Web 扩展开发框架
- 阿里巴巴面试题之系统设计大揭秘
- 为何不推荐使用 Date 类
- 探索.NET9 的 FCall/QCall 调用约定
- Rust 编写脚手架:关于 Clap 的那些事
- 2024 年 JavaScript 的六大新功能
- C++中 const* 与 *const 的深入剖析及区分